Responsibilities:
- Review and establish project intent through project-specific documents, specifications, and drawings; develop and maintain a project schedule, coordinating needs with the project team, and identifying time‑sensitive installation needs.
- Manage financials, requisition supplies and materials, project cost reviews, and backlog to ensure favorable billing position, drive revenue, and meet monthly and quarterly goals; coordinate project‑specific billing with accounting team and Operations Manager.
- Conduct project orientation for technicians, provide necessary documentation, manage and coordinate subcontractors, track resources and project progress, document impactful events, pursue change‑order opportunities, and schedule commissioning resources.
- Complete project‑specific close‑out documentation, expedite the return of mark‑ups for as‑built development, maintain life‑safety systems during installation, migration, or replacement, and professionally represent the company to the owner or owner’s representative throughout the project.
- Adhere to local, corporate, and OSHA safety policies and procedures; report unsafe conditions and actions, and effectively manage and coordinate subcontractors to meet scope, scheduling, and financial requirements.
- Work in a team environment, providing dedicated support to our customers.
Qualifications:
- Basic Qualifications:
- On‑the‑job experience with project management, engineering internship, or related work experience.
- Must be able to demonstrate knowledge and understanding of commercial fire alarm / life safety systems or related low voltage systems; ability to read and understand basic electrical drawings and customer specifications.
- Knowledge and understanding of industry applications; ability to read and understand drawings and specifications, and electrical, network, and control wiring diagrams.
- Experience with Microsoft Office.
- High School Diploma or state‑recognized GED.
- Verbal and written communication skills in English.
- Must be 21 years of age and possess a valid driver’s license with limited violations; must meet eligibility requirements to participate in Siemens’ fleet vehicle program.
- Legally authorized to work in the United States on a continual and permanent basis without company sponsorship.
- Preferred Qualifications:
- Associate degree or Bachelor of Mechanical or Electrical Engineering degree.
- Microsoft Project.
- 2+ years of technical experience in the commercial fire and life safety industry.
- Knowledgeable in local and national (NFPA) fire alarm codes and regulations.
- State of Ohio fire alarm license.
- NICET I certification or higher.
Pay Range: $50,000 – $86,000 annually with a target incentive of 5% of the base salary. The actual wage offered may be lower or higher depending on budget and candidate experience, knowledge, skills, qualifications, and premium geographic location.
